It's because of the noise blanker fellows. I can make a FT1000 series or
almost any Yaesu test anywhere from 60- 80 dB for IM3 by fiddling with the
bias on the NB amplifier FET. That why the best policy is to turn the thing
off whenever the NB is off by changing the circuitry.

The distressing thing to me is despite telling them over and over again it
is a problem, they keep copying the same design into new versions. Talk
about a Ford Pinto gas tank syndrome!
